About this website:

The website Radleyaustralia.com raises several red flags that indicate it may be a scam: New Domain: The domain was registered very recently, which is a common tactic for scam websites. Legitimate businesses usually have a longer online presence. Lack of Company Information: The website provides no information about the company, such as its history, location, or team. This lack of transparency is suspicious. Unrealistic Discounts: The significant discounts offered on the products, such as handbags and wallets, are often a tactic used by scam websites to lure in unsuspecting customers. Poor Website Design: The website's design appears unprofessional and lacks the polish and attention to detail typically seen in legitimate online stores. No Customer Reviews: A lack of customer reviews or testimonials is another warning sign. Established businesses usually have a track record of customer feedback. No Social Media Presence: Legitimate businesses often have a presence on social media platforms. The absence of this can be a red flag. No Secure Payment Options: The website may not offer secure payment options, such as using a credit card through a trusted payment gateway. This can put customers' financial information at risk. Spelling and Grammar Errors: Scam websites often have noticeable errors in spelling and grammar on their pages, which can indicate a lack of professionalism. Lack of Contact Information: The website may not provide clear contact information, such as a physical address and phone number, making it difficult for customers to reach them. Unverifiable Claims: If the website makes claims that are difficult to verify, such as being the "best" or having the "lowest prices," it can be a red flag. To protect yourself from potential scams, it's important to be cautious when dealing with unfamiliar online stores. Look for reviews and information about the company from independent sources, and consider using secure payment methods that offer buyer protection. If in doubt, it may be safer to shop from well-established and reputable retailers."
